Interfaz IBackgroundCopyJobHttpOptions (bits2_5.h)
Use esta interfaz para especificar certificados de cliente para la autenticación de cliente basada en certificados y encabezados personalizados para las solicitudes HTTP.
Para obtener esta interfaz, llame al método IBackgroundCopyJob::QueryInterface mediante __uuidof(IBackgroundCopyJobHttpOptions) para el identificador de interfaz.
Herencia
La interfaz IBackgroundCopyJobHttpOptions hereda de la interfaz IUnknown . IBackgroundCopyJobHttpOptions también tiene estos tipos de miembros:
Métodos
La interfaz IBackgroundCopyJobHttpOptions tiene estos métodos.
IBackgroundCopyJobHttpOptions::GetClientCertificate Recupera el certificado de cliente del trabajo. |
IBackgroundCopyJobHttpOptions::GetCustomHeaders Recupera los encabezados personalizados establecidos por una llamada anterior a IBackgroundCopyJobHttpOptions::SetCustomHeaders (es decir, los encabezados que BITS enviarán al remoto, no los encabezados que BITS recibe del remoto). |
IBackgroundCopyJobHttpOptions::GetSecurityFlags Recupera las marcas de HTTP que determinan si se comprueba la lista de revocación de certificados y se omiten determinados errores de certificado y la directiva que se va a usar cuando un servidor redirige la solicitud HTTP. |
IBackgroundCopyJobHttpOptions::RemoveClientCertificate Quita el certificado de cliente del trabajo. |
IBackgroundCopyJobHttpOptions::SetClientCertificateByID Especifica el identificador del certificado de cliente que se va a usar para la autenticación de cliente en una solicitud HTTPS (SSL). |
IBackgroundCopyJobHttpOptions::SetClientCertificateByName Especifica el nombre del firmante del certificado de cliente que se va a usar para la autenticación de cliente en una solicitud HTTPS (SSL). |
IBackgroundCopyJobHttpOptions::SetCustomHeaders Especifica uno o varios encabezados HTTP personalizados que se van a incluir en las solicitudes HTTP. |
IBackgroundCopyJobHttpOptions::SetSecurityFlags Establece marcas para HTTP que determinan si se comprueba la lista de revocación de certificados y se omiten determinados errores de certificado y la directiva que se va a usar cuando un servidor redirige la solicitud HTTP. |
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ows Vista |
Servidor mínimo compatible | Windows Server 2008 |
Plataforma de destino | Windows |
Encabezado | bits2_5.h (incluya Bits.h) |